Myra Colton, an eighteen year old, down-to-earth girl from San Francisco who just got accepted into New York’s Brooklyn College convinces her mother to let her go to New York ahead of the scheduled time. She was supposed to go and stay with her Aunt Fay in January, when her classes began, but she wants to go earlier to get used to the idea of living in New York once again. Her problems rise when she notices the strange family next door, whom Aunt Fay recalls as "nice people". No matter what her Aunt says, Myra is positive there's something off about that family...especially with that weird, gloomy son of theirs with who she immediately starts off the wrong foot with. Dan Remington, youngest of three sons and two daughters, known as the "loner" of the family. Though a loner, his love for his family is well-known and he would do anything for his family even at the cost of his life. Amongst the already amount of stress on his lap, more stress is thrown on him when the neighbor's niece starts getting suspicious about his family, and he's not about to let her find out.........
